Abstract
The bond lengths in the central C—O—C ether linkage of title compound (1), C13H8N2O5S, are comparable with those found in earlier work on similar compounds. However,(1) was found to undergo very easy solvolysis with ethanol to give (2), C9H9NO3S, for which a structure was also determined, but 3-(4-methoxyphenoxy)-1, 2-benzisothiazole 1, 1- dioxide,(3), did not hydrolyse under the same conditions.
